Steps to Take After Falling for a Fake Email Scam

So you just realized that email from your bank was actually a fake and now you’re panicking about what to do next.
Take a deep breath and follow these steps:
1. Change Your Passwords: Start by changing the password to any accounts that might have been compromised. This includes your email, online banking, and even social media accounts.
2. Alert Your Bank or Credit Card Company: If the scammer managed to get access to your financial information, notify your bank or credit card company right away. They can help freeze your account and prevent further damage.
3. Check Your Credit Report: Keep an eye on your credit report in case the scammers try to open new lines of credit in your name.
4. Have your computer cleaned and tuned by a computer professional. If you are a do it yourselfer, there are plenty of free options available if you don’t want to spend money on a paid program.
5. Educate Yourself: Learn how to spot fake emails in the future. Exercise caution when opening attachments or clicking links, especially if they seem suspicious.
Remember, falling for a fake email scam is embarrassing but it doesn’t have to be catastrophic. By taking these steps, you can minimize the damage and keep yourself safe in the future.
